The Utilization Management Coordinator ensures cost-effective, high-quality care by managing treatment team meetings, utilization review processes, and coordinating discharge planning as a residential care navigator. This role involves submitting and tracking insurance authorizations, maintaining compliance, and serving as a liaison between clinical teams and external stakeholders.
Candidates must possess a Bachelor's degree in a related field along with at least one year of experience in behavioral health, utilization management, or discharge planning, preferably with a background in case management. Essential qualifications include a strong understanding of payer requirements and medical necessity criteria, coupled with excellent communication and organizational abilities.

Education and/or Experience Bachelor’s degree in a related field with 1+ years of experience in behavioral health, utilization management, or discharge planning. Preferably a background in case management. Strong understanding of payer requirements, medical necessity criteria, and behavioral health systems of care. Excellent communication, organizational, and problem-solving skills. Proficiency in electronic health records (EHR), preferably myEvolv.
